noun
- Decorative vases or containers designed to hold cut branches or flowering boughs for indoor display.
Usage: Plural form of boughpot; Chiefly British; Somewhat archaic or formal
Examples
- The antique boughpots on the mantelpiece held fresh spring blossoms.
- She arranged cherry boughs in the porcelain boughpots for the dinner party.
- Victorian homes often featured decorative boughpots filled with seasonal flowers.
- The museum displayed a collection of 18th-century boughpots made of blue and white ceramic.
